Skip to content

Commit 9769cbe

Browse files
committed
fix for webpack 2 DefinePlugin
1 parent a99b570 commit 9769cbe

File tree

1 file changed

+14
-4
lines changed

1 file changed

+14
-4
lines changed

src/server/config/utils.js

Lines changed: 14 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-41,8 +41,18 @@ export function loadEnv(options = {}) {
4141
.forEach((name) => {
4242
env[name] = process.env[name];
4343
});
44-
45-
return {
46-
'process.env': JSON.stringify(env),
47-
};
44+
45+
if (webpackVersion == 2) {
46+
Object.keys(env).forEach((name) => {
47+
env[name] = JSON.stringify(env[name])
48+
})
49+
return {
50+
'process.env': env
51+
}
52+
}
53+
else {
54+
return {
55+
'process.env': JSON.stringify(env),
56+
};
57+
}
4858
}

0 commit comments

Comments
 (0)